The Pittsburgh Steelers have released their 2026 training camp schedule, detailing key dates and events for fans and players. The camp will take place in Latrobe, Pennsylvania, marking the 59th year at Saint Vincent College. The schedule includes 16 practice
sessions, with players reporting on July 28 and practices beginning on July 29. A highlight of the camp will be the preseason game against the Green Bay Packers on August 13. The training camp is a significant event for the Steelers, providing an opportunity for players to prepare for the upcoming season and for fans to engage with the team.
